Lead Educator salary break down is:
CS Level 4.1 Hourly Rate - $33.15 per hour + super
CS Level 4.2 Hourly Rate - $33.66 per hour + super
CS Level 4.3 Hourly Rate - $34.16 per hour + super

Key Selection Criteria:
- ACECQA approved qualification for Educators working with over preschool children
- Current Victorian Working with Children's Check and Victorian Drivers' Licence.
- Current certificate in "HLTAID012 Provide First Aid in an education & care setting" (First Aid and Asthma & Anaphylaxis Management) or willingness to undertake before start
- Current certificate in "HLTAID009 Prov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ation" (CPR) or willingness to undertake before start
- Understanding of the needs and development of school age children
- Previous experience and/or Food Safety Handling certificate would be an advantage
- Demonstrated experience in working within the National Quality Framework
- Demonstrated ability and understanding of developing positive relationships with children and families
- Willingness to promote and support practices that are inclusive, culturally responsive, safe and accessible.
- Willingness to undertake pre-employment screening - Working with Children, Police check and medical assessment.
- Current Victorian Drivers' Licence.
- Right to Work in Australia e.g. Australian Citizen or Permanent Resident
